UK updates penalties for breaking biometrics rules for digital visas
July 19, 2023, 7:47 p.m. | Joel R. McConvey
Biometric Update www.biometricupdate.com
Governments continue to pursue secure systems for biometric immigration control, but human opportunism remains a problem.
This week the UK published an update to its “code of practice about sanctions for non-compliance with the biometric registration regulations” attached to Biometric Immigration Documents (BIDs). The UK began rolling out BIDs in 2008, to replace potentially insecure immigration documents such as letters or ink stamps.
